BANKRUPTCY PROCESS - FILING INFORMATION
In order for you to have a smooth filing here are a few tips:
1. Complete the Credit Counseling to receive your certificate before filing. (for approved agencies please visit http://www.justice.gov/ust/eo/bapcpa/ccde/cc_approved.htm We recommend (http://www.abacuscc.org/)
2. Include last 60 days of paystubs with the documents provided.
3. Include Credit Counseling Certificate with your filing.
4. File all documents both the original and a copy with the Clerkâs Office along with your filing fee or fee waiver, the copy will be stamped and given back you for your records.
(If you are mailing the documents, be sure to include both the original and a copy and send along a self-addressed stamped envelope, so that the copy can be mailed back to you for your records.)
5. After filing, complete the Personal Financial Course. (this course can be completed with the same company you completed the Credit Counseling with)
6. After receiving the Certificate complete the B23 form (included in your documents) and file with the Clerk. (both Certificate and B23 form must be filed within 45 days of your 341 Meeting of the Creditors Hearing)
7. After you file, you will receive a notice of your meeting of the creditors along with the name and address of your Trustee, you must mail your most recent tax return to the Trustee.
To be safe, also bring a copy of your most recent tax return with you to your meeting of the creditors along with your ID and social security card.
